Abstract

In this study, the levels of vitamin B1 (Thiamine), vitamin B2 (Riboflavin), vitamin B3 (Nicotinamide), vitamin B6 (Pyridoxine), vitamin B11 (Folic Acid) and vitamin B12 (Cobalamin) in the soils amended with and without wastewater sludge were determined by high performance liquid cromatography (HPLC). According to our results, in the soils which had wastewater sludge and cultivated common vetch plant and in the control soil groups which had no fertilizer and plant, vitamin B1, B2, B3, B6, B11 and B12 levels were determined as 0,40 ± 0.06, 0,62±0.10 μg/g; 0,60±0.10, 0,36±0.06 μg/g; 0,54±0.09, 0,43±0.07μg/g; 1,23±0.25, 0,80±0.13μg/g ; 0,69±0.11, 0,46±0.07μg/g; 19,09±0.30, 25,85±5.17 μg/g, respectively. In control group soils without plant, Riboflavin (B2), Nicotinamide (B3), Pyridoxine (B6) and Folic Acid (B11) levels increased with wastewater sludge amendment. Consequently, it was determined that wastewater sludge as fertilizer in land increases some vitamin B levels of organic matter content of soil. [ABSTRACT FROM AUTHOR]
